We are hiring a Developer in Test
Hybrid working model - Novi Sad or Belgrade office
Role Description:
We are seeking a highly motivated Developer in Test with strong C# development skills, proven experience automating backend application tests, and solid API testing experience to join our growing engineering team. In this role, you will play a key part in ensuring the quality, stability, and reliability of software solutions through a strong focus on test automation, technical testing, and engineering excellence. You will work closely with developers, product teams, and other quality engineers to build quality into the software development lifecycle while continuously improving testing frameworks, CI/CD pipelines, and development practices.
Key Responsibilities:
Design, develop, and maintain automated test solutions using the same coding languages, tools, and standards as the development team
Create reliable, scalable, and efficient automated tests while minimizing manual testing activities
Investigate test failures, troubleshoot issues, and continuously improve test automation effectiveness
Leverage AI-powered development tools such as GitHub Copilot, ChatGPT, or similar technologies to accelerate test development and improve productivity
Develop, maintain, and enhance CI/CD pipelines to support efficient software delivery
Perform root cause analysis of defects and investigate issues directly within the application code when required
Collaborate closely with engineers, product owners, and stakeholders in software design discussions, user story refinement, and acceptance criteria definition
Mentor team members on automation best practices and contribute to automation backlog initiatives
Act as a subject matter expert for product and testing knowledge, actively participating in knowledge-sharing activities across engineering teams
Continuously advocate for quality, innovation, and engineering excellence throughout the development lifecycle
Your Profile:
3+ years of hands-on experience with C#, including writing unit and integration tests, creating mocks and stubs, and working with mocking frameworks
Strong experience designing, developing, and maintaining automated test frameworks
Minimum 2+ years of experience in API testing
Proven experience with test automation, technical testing, and quality engineering practices
Experience working with Docker and knowledge in building and optimizing CI/CD pipelines
Solid understanding of software testing concepts, methodologies, processes, and best practices
Understanding of web technologies, including RESTful APIs, web services, and application servers
Familiarity with, or strong interest in, using AI-powered tools such as GitHub Copilot, ChatGPT, or similar solutions to improve development and testing workflows
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to investigate complex issues and perform root cause analysis
Ability to quickly learn new technologies and adapt to fast-paced, complex environments
Comfortable participating in and driving technical discussions with engineering teams
Collaborative mindset with strong communication and stakeholder management skills
Proactive approach to personal development, ownership, and continuous improvement
Passion for software quality and delivering exceptional user experiences
Plus if you have:
Experience mentoring team members and promoting automation best practices
Experience working in cloud-based environments
Knowledge of performance or end-to-end testing
Experience contributing to software architecture discussions and Agile delivery teams
Experience with energy trading, financial services, or other highly transactional systems
